Output 6ef15aba6b7e5d3e59217183f4cdcae014934ec04df9862553c80f5f08fab48e:3

value
1060667725
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d439178745dee5639624efcc6e0ab8947789498 OP_EQUAL
address
34MkTq8tvaNgWPsnjdnuSaxhrUCKHYn4As
transaction
6ef15aba6b7e5d3e59217183f4cdcae014934ec04df9862553c80f5f08fab48e
spent
true